BlackRock acquires organics-to-renewable energy firm Vanguard Renewables

TAGS

Vanguard Renewables, an American organics-to-renewable energy developer, has been acquired from a fund managed by BlackRock Real Assets from Vision Ridge Partners for an undisclosed price.

Based in Wellesley, Massachusetts, Vanguard Renewables develops food and dairy waste-to-renewable energy projects. Founded in 2014, the company has on-farm anaerobic digester facilities, which it owns and operates in the US northeast.

Presently, Vanguard Renewables operates manure-only digesters for Dominion Energy in the south and the west US.

BlackRock Real Assets is expected to help Vanguard Renewables in commissioning over 100 anaerobic digesters to produce renewable natural gas across the US by 2026.

Mark Florian — BlackRock Real Assets Head of Diversified Infrastructure said: “We are pleased to invest in Vanguard Renewables, a leading producer of renewable natural gas from agriculture and organic food waste in the U.S., supported by long-term contracts.

“Renewable natural gas is an attractive and fast-growing market that provides decarbonization solutions for both the provider of the waste, as well as the natural gas consumer. We look forward to partnering with Vanguard Renewables’ experienced management team to support the company’s strong growth momentum.”

Vanguard Renewables is said to mitigate greenhouse gas emissions from cow manure and food waste via a couple of distinct business lines called Vanguard Organics and Vanguard Ag.

The Farm Powered anaerobic codigestion process of Vanguard Organics is said to convert inedible beverage and food waste and dairy manure into renewable natural gas as well as liquid low-carbon fertilizer.

Vanguard Ag, on the other hand, was jointly formed with Dominion Energy in 2019 for converting manure into renewable natural gas.
